What Is Single Dose Manufacturing?

Single Dose Manufacturing refers to the production of products packaged in pre-measured, single-use formats. These formats are designed so that each unit contains a controlled amount of product for one application, one use occasion, or one defined product experience.

Unlike conventional bulk packaging or repeated-use containers, single dose manufacturing requires the formulation, package, filling method, sealing process, material compatibility, documentation readiness, and procurement risk to be considered together from the beginning of product development.

Basic Definition

Single Dose Manufacturing is the manufacturing discipline behind products that are filled, sealed, and delivered in individual use units.

The category includes formats such as ampoules, sachets, stick packs, unit dose packaging, and other single-use packaging systems. The defining feature is not only the size of the package, but the relationship between the product formula, packaging format, production process, and intended use structure.

This is why single dose packaging should not be treated as a simple container choice. In many projects, the package becomes part of the product system itself.

Why Single Dose Manufacturing Is Different

Single dose manufacturing is different from traditional OEM manufacturing because the package, formula, filling process, and sealing method are more tightly connected.

In a conventional bottle or jar format, packaging may often be evaluated after the formula and commercial format are already defined. In single dose projects, packaging decisions can affect whether the product can be filled consistently, sealed reliably, stored appropriately, and reviewed through a suitable project process.

This makes packaging format selection, filling method, sealing process, and seal integrity central to the manufacturing discussion.

Core Manufacturing Factors

A single dose project is shaped by several connected manufacturing factors.

These include the behavior of the formulation, the suitability of the packaging material, the filling setup, the sealing process, leakage risk, stability review, documentation readiness, MOQ factors, lead time factors, and procurement risk.

For example, a formula that works well in a bulk container may still require additional review before it is placed into a small single-use package. The interaction between formulation compatibility and packaging material compatibility can influence packaging decisions, project timelines, and sample evaluation.

Common Packaging Formats

Single dose manufacturing may involve several packaging formats, depending on the product type, formulation behavior, use context, and manufacturing feasibility.

Common formats include plastic ampoules, glass ampoules, sachets, stick packs, and other unit dose systems. Each format has different implications for filling, sealing, material selection, leakage risk, handling, and documentation.

No format is universally best. A suitable format depends on the relationship between the formulation, packaging material, project requirements, and manufacturing process.

Procurement and Project Evaluation

Single dose manufacturing should not be evaluated only by unit price.

Procurement teams and product developers need to consider procurement risk, documentation readiness, MOQ factors, lead time factors, sample review, packaging complexity, and production feasibility. A lower quoted price does not automatically mean a lower-risk project.
